XIV

Come new song, rise forth and dance!
Turn my tongue to a waterfall
flush with the floods of spring!
Rise up o hands of celebration-
draw in your finger's width the wealth
of all morning's joy and let the light fly through!
Flow forth laughter sweet and sweep the shadows clear!
Send it ringing with its golden tone
a thousand bells to wake the streets.
O city come and dance with me!
This is the birth morn of a dream
a world, a life where I live free
and none can call me convict condemned!
Shout with me crowds and kings!
Taste on your weary tongues the sweet redemption.
Let the gnashing teeth fall silent.
Quieted be the cries of the unjust in the city
and let the mouths of fools be covered.
Silence all! For here rides the King
with love in his hand and peace for his people.
Breathe deep the wonder of his presence.
Now!
Let the children scream, the women dance and the men weep.
This is the day of the LORD.
Greet it with a new song.
Slave is thy name no longer!
Love and be free!
May the name of the LORD be a blessing
upon this land and this people.
How great is His glory and how worthy of honor He stands!
Greet Him with praise and serve with joy!
Blessed be the freedom ringer. Blessed be.
Amen
